I feel like a putz for asking this, but is there more then one way to drain the oil in the crankcase? I've been using the plug under the right side of my engine which also contains the oil filter and spring, but I recently found a major crack around the threads of that plug, and don't want to touch it until my new one comes in this week. Right now it's sealing, so I don't wanna tempt fate.
Problem is, I need to change the oil to attempt getting it out of the bush. Is there a "main drain' I'm not seeing on this thing? If so, does anyone have a picture? _________________ 05' Carter Talon GSX 150 2R

mike there is another drain plug look on drivers side across from the big plug with screen you are talking about that is crack.the one on the drivers side is the won they recommend to use when changing oil
i always do both pull drivers side plug drain oil ,then pull the big plug with screen to check for metal cuttings and dirt in the screen.i know that one is giving you trouble so you just do drivers side to get it back home.
